What a game.. everyone remember we had the lead at halftime?

Like U of I 89-05-10 said, it wasn't just the 15-point deficit with 4 minutes to go that made the comeback special. The score was 77-68 with 1:30 to go. 9 points in 90 seconds is tough to overcome in the college game.

(9 points was also the deficit Kansas had to overcome against Memphis in the 2008 NC game, with 2:12 to go. Memphis helped out by going 1-5 in FTs down the stretch.)

Unlike Memphis, Arizona hit their FTs, going 5-6 during the comeback.

The Illini went on their crazy run fueled by creating turnovers. After the 1:30 mark, Illinois scored 12 points in 50 seconds to tie the game. Absolutely ridiculous.

I know everyone remembers Deron's contributions but pay close attention and watch what Luther did. He was always the unsung hero and quiet leader. Watch when the run starts, Deron starts it and then it was back and forth between him and Luther, then luther gets a steal, goes back and forth between Deron and luther, Dee gets a layup, Jack knocks the ball away sets a screen and the ball is passed to Deron and he hits a three. It was a team effort.

Arrogance really cost Arizona. Stoudamire and Frye and the Arizona bench celebrated too early. That game will always stand out in their mind.
